realurl prevar 语言和获取参数
realurl prevar language and get parameter
我有一个奇怪的问题:
TYPO3 7.6 与 realul 2.2.1
我得到了一个带有表格的页面。表单的一个字段通过获取参数 (sysid=xxxxx) 进行预填充。
该站点是多语言的:德语->0,英语->1,通过 prevars '' 和 en 映射。
当我通过 www.domain.tld/form-page/?sysid=xxxxx 调用页面时,我可以获取 get 参数并填写字段。
当我通过 www.domain.tld/en/form-page/?sysid=xxxxx 调用页面时,我得到一个 404。这很奇怪,因为 www.domain.tld/en/form-page/ 没有任何工作问题。
我尝试了几种设置(例如从 chash 生成中排除 sysid)但没有任何效果。
有什么提示吗?
一个额外的注意事项:getvar 链接不是在 TYPO3 中生成的,它们是通过条形码调用的。
我无法在相同版本的 T3 和 realurl 上重现您的问题。
而且我猜(随意猜测),这不是 realurl 问题,而是 TYPO3 核心问题。
您能否尝试通过以下方式调用该页面:
www.domain.tld/index.php?id=XX&L=1&sysid=xxxxx
进一步调查并告诉我们您的设置
[FE][pageNotFound_handling] 并根据 (installtool/LocalConfiguration).
没关系。发生错误是因为我在上线后没有调整域的 realurl-setting。因此发生了自动配置,但没有用。使用手动 conf 它可以工作。
我有一个奇怪的问题: TYPO3 7.6 与 realul 2.2.1
我得到了一个带有表格的页面。表单的一个字段通过获取参数 (sysid=xxxxx) 进行预填充。
该站点是多语言的:德语->0,英语->1,通过 prevars '' 和 en 映射。
当我通过 www.domain.tld/form-page/?sysid=xxxxx 调用页面时,我可以获取 get 参数并填写字段。
当我通过 www.domain.tld/en/form-page/?sysid=xxxxx 调用页面时,我得到一个 404。这很奇怪,因为 www.domain.tld/en/form-page/ 没有任何工作问题。
我尝试了几种设置(例如从 chash 生成中排除 sysid)但没有任何效果。
有什么提示吗?
一个额外的注意事项:getvar 链接不是在 TYPO3 中生成的,它们是通过条形码调用的。
我无法在相同版本的 T3 和 realurl 上重现您的问题。 而且我猜(随意猜测),这不是 realurl 问题,而是 TYPO3 核心问题。 您能否尝试通过以下方式调用该页面: www.domain.tld/index.php?id=XX&L=1&sysid=xxxxx
进一步调查并告诉我们您的设置 [FE][pageNotFound_handling] 并根据 (installtool/LocalConfiguration).
没关系。发生错误是因为我在上线后没有调整域的 realurl-setting。因此发生了自动配置,但没有用。使用手动 conf 它可以工作。